To check the oil level on an Ingersoll Rand air compressor, first power down and depressurize the unit. Let it cool. Then, locate the oil sight glass or dipstick, typically on the pump crankcase. The oil level must sit between the “minimum” and “maximum” marks.

Signs of Low Oil
Your Ingersoll Rand compressor might show signs of low oil. Do not ignore these warnings. One common sign is increased noise from the pump. You might hear grinding or knocking sounds. This noise indicates parts are rubbing without enough lubrication. Another sign is reduced performance. The compressor might take longer to build pressure. It might struggle to reach its maximum PSI.
You could also notice the compressor running hotter than usual. Touching the pump, it might feel excessively hot. Some modern Ingersoll Rand units have low oil pressure switches. These switches can shut down the compressor automatically. They prevent damage. Always check the oil indicator first if you notice any of these issues. Acting quickly can save your compressor.

Safety First: Power Off and Depressurize
Safety is paramount when working with any air compressor. First, turn off your Ingersoll Rand air compressor. Locate the power switch or breaker. Flip it to the “off” position. Then, unplug the compressor from its power source. This step prevents accidental starting. It eliminates any electrical hazards.
Next, you must depressurize the air tank. Open the drain valve or a hose valve. Allow all compressed air to escape. You will hear a hissing sound as the air releases. Wait until the pressure gauge reads zero. This process ensures there is no residual pressure in the system. Working on a pressurized tank is extremely dangerous.
Allow Cooling Time
The compressor pump gets hot during operation. Oil also expands when hot. Checking the oil when the compressor is hot gives an inaccurate reading. It will likely appear higher than the actual cold level. For the most accurate measurement, let the compressor cool down completely.
This cooling period can take anywhere from 10 minutes to an hour. It depends on how long the compressor ran. A good rule of thumb is to wait until the pump feels cool to the touch. Patience here pays off. It ensures you get a true reading of the oil level. This prevents both underfilling and overfilling.
Gathering Tools and Location
You do not need many tools for an oil check. A clean rag or paper towel is essential. You might need a flashlight if the compressor is in a dim area. This helps you see the oil level indicator clearly. Keep a bottle of the correct Ingersoll Rand compressor oil nearby, just in case.
Position your compressor on a level surface. This is important for accurate readings. If the compressor is tilted, the oil inside will shift. This shifting can make the sight glass or dipstick show an incorrect level. A level surface ensures the oil settles properly. This gives you the most precise measurement every time.

Sight Glass vs. Dipstick
An oil sight glass is a clear window. It is typically a small, circular glass or plastic window. You can find it on the side of the compressor pump’s crankcase. It allows you to see the oil level directly. You just look through the window. The oil will appear as a dark line. This method is quick and easy. It requires no disassembly.
A dipstick is similar to what you find in a car engine. It is a long, thin metal rod. It usually has a handle or a cap. You pull it out to check the oil. The dipstick inserts into a port on the compressor pump. It has marks that show the minimum and maximum oil levels. Both methods work well. They both give you an accurate oil reading.
Where to Find Them on Different Models
The exact location of the oil indicator varies by model. On many portable Ingersoll Rand air compressors, the sight glass is on the front or side of the pump. It is usually near the bottom of the pump assembly. Look for a clear, round window. It often has “MIN” and “MAX” lines directly on or next to it.
For larger stationary units, a dipstick might be present. It is often located on the top or side of the crankcase. It might be integrated into the oil fill cap. The cap might have a small handle. Simply unscrew and pull it out. Always double-check your specific model’s manual. The manual shows the precise location for your unit.
Understanding the Markings (Min/Max Lines)
Both sight glasses and dipsticks use clear markings. These marks indicate the acceptable oil level range. You will see lines labeled “MIN” (minimum) and “MAX” (maximum) or “FULL”. For a sight glass, the oil level should sit somewhere between these two lines. Ideally, it should be at or just below the “MAX” line.
If your compressor uses a dipstick, pull it out and wipe it clean first. Reinsert it fully. Then pull it out again to read the level. The oil mark should fall between the “MIN” and “MAX” notches. Never let the oil drop below the “MIN” line. Also, do not fill it above the “MAX” line. Both conditions can harm your compressor. Checking with a Sight Glass
Checking oil with a sight glass is very straightforward. First, make sure your compressor is on a level surface. This ensures the oil settles correctly. Next, look at the clear window on the side of the pump. You will see the oil inside. The oil appears as a darker area.
The sight glass will have lines or indicators. These marks show the minimum and maximum oil levels. The oil should be visible between these two lines. Ideally, it should be at or near the upper (MAX) mark. If you cannot see the oil at all, it is definitely too low. If it is above the MAX line, it is overfilled. I use a flashlight sometimes to get a better view.
Checking with a Dipstick
If your Ingersoll Rand compressor has a dipstick, the process is slightly different. First, locate the dipstick. It is usually a cap on the pump with a rod attached. Pull the dipstick out of its port. Use a clean rag or paper towel to wipe the metal rod completely clean. Remove all oil residue.
Next, reinsert the dipstick fully into its port. Push it down until it seats properly. Then, pull the dipstick out again. This time, look at the end of the rod. You will see a wet oil mark. This mark indicates the current oil level. The dipstick has notches or lines labeled “MIN” and “MAX.” The oil level must fall within these marks. It should be close to the “MAX” line.

Importance of Not Overfilling
When adding oil, do it slowly and carefully. Do not overfill the compressor. Overfilling can be as damaging as underfilling. If you put too much oil, the crankcase becomes pressurized. This pressure can force oil into the air lines. This contaminates your compressed air. Oil in the air lines can damage your tools. It can also lead to oil burning.
Oil burning creates smoke. It can also cause oil leaks. Always add small amounts. Then recheck the level frequently. Aim for the oil level to be at or just below the “MAX” line. Never exceed this mark. A funnel helps prevent spills. It also allows you to pour precisely.

When to Change Oil
Ingersoll Rand provides specific guidelines for oil changes. These intervals depend on the compressor model and usage. Generally, you should change the oil every few hundred hours of operation. For example, some models recommend changes every 200-300 hours. Heavy-duty units might have longer intervals, especially with synthetic oil.
Refer to your compressor’s manual for the exact oil change schedule. Mark the date of the last oil change. This helps you track. Changing the oil regularly is vital. It removes old, degraded oil. It replaces it with fresh, protective lubrication. This maintains the compressor’s health. It boosts its performance. It also helps in maintaining the overall system. Checking When Hot or Running
This is a very frequent mistake. Never check the oil level while the compressor is running. The oil is circulating. It is also under pressure. This makes any reading inaccurate. It is also very dangerous. Moving parts pose a serious injury risk.
Similarly, do not check the oil immediately after the compressor stops. The oil needs time to settle back into the crankcase. It also needs to cool down. Hot oil expands. This expansion makes the oil level appear higher than it truly is. Always wait for the compressor to cool and depressurize. This ensures an accurate reading.
Overfilling the Oil
Another common error is adding too much oil. When the oil level is low, it is tempting to just pour it in. However, overfilling causes problems. Excess oil creates too much pressure inside the crankcase. This pressure can blow seals. It can force oil past piston rings.
If oil gets into the air lines, it contaminates your tools. It can also damage sensitive equipment connected to the compressor. Excess oil can also cause frothing. This frothing reduces the oil’s lubrication ability. Always add oil slowly. Recheck the level frequently. Stop adding when the oil reaches the “MAX” line.
Using the Wrong Oil Type
This mistake can be very damaging. Using automotive engine oil or hydraulic fluid is a definite no-go. These oils lack the specific properties needed for compressor pumps. Compressor oil has anti-foaming agents. It handles the extreme pressures and temperatures of a compressor. It also resists carbon buildup.
Engine oil can create harmful carbon deposits. These deposits clog valves. They can cause premature wear. Always use the oil specified by Ingersoll Rand. Refer to your owner’s manual. If you cannot find the exact type, consult an Ingersoll Rand dealer. Using the correct oil ensures proper lubrication. It protects internal components. It helps extend the compressor’s life. Can I use motor oil in my Ingersoll Rand air compressor?
No, you should not use motor oil in your Ingersoll Rand air compressor. Motor oil contains detergents and other additives designed for combustion engines. These additives can create carbon deposits in a compressor pump, leading to valve issues and premature wear. Always use a dedicated, non-detergent air compressor oil.
What happens if my Ingersoll Rand compressor runs low on oil?
If your Ingersoll Rand compressor runs low on oil, its moving parts will lack proper lubrication. This causes increased friction, leading to overheating and rapid wear of components like pistons and bearings. The compressor may also experience reduced performance, make abnormal noises, or even seize up completely, resulting in costly repairs.
Where is the oil fill cap on an Ingersoll Rand air compressor?
The oil fill cap on an Ingersoll Rand air compressor is typically located on the top or side of the compressor pump’s crankcase. It is often a screw-on cap, sometimes with a dipstick attached. Its exact location can vary by model, so consulting your specific owner’s manual is always the best way to locate it precisely.
Is it normal for an air compressor to consume oil?
Yes, it is normal for air compressors to consume a small amount of oil over time. This consumption is usually due to small amounts of oil mist being carried out with the compressed air or through normal wear on piston rings and seals. However, excessive oil consumption can indicate a problem like worn rings, seals, or an overfilled crankcase, which requires investigation.
